UPDATE:

Condition referred for:
Hyperadrenergic Postural Orthostatic Tachycardia Syndrome (POTS)

AMRO/IRILO: UNFIT

10 SEP 2021:
PCM referred for AMRO Board and code 37 was approved.
29 SEP 2021: PEBLO sends MEB interview questionnaire.
30 SEP 2021: PEBLO reaches out for initial PEBLO briefing to go over IRILO/MEB process.
30 SEP 2021: PEBLO sends CIS to CC.
1 OCT 2021: Meeting with 1st Sgt to discuss my preference in regards to Retain or Do Not Retain. Requested Do Not Retain.
15 OCT 2021: Commander returns CIS (Do Not Retain).
29 OCT 2021: MEB doctor now has my case. PEBLO projects my IRILO board to occur 2nd week of December. Waiting on NARSUM from MEB doctor.
15 NOV 2021: PEBLO says that MEB doctor needs to reach out to my neurologist for clarification on my condition such as Prognosis and Severity. Projects 1 to 2 week wait for response from provider.
7 JAN 2022: Package sent to IRILO board for AFPC/DP2NP determination
18 JAN 2022: AFPC/DP2NP determines member needs Full MEB

MEB: UNFIT

19 JAN 2022:
Appointment with PEBLO to discuss IDES/LDES
20 JAN 2022: Officially entered IDES
3 FEB 2022: VA MSC reaches out and asks for things I want to claim.
7 FEB 2022: Meeting with MSC to do all the paperwork on things I want to claim.
17 FEB 2022: General Doctor QTC, Blood work, xray, PFT
23 FEB 2022: Audiogram
23 FEB 2022: Psychological (Last QTC appt)
10 MAR 2022: All DBQs uploaded to TOL and exams marked completed on QTC examinee portal.
25 MAR 2022: MEB found me unfit, 618 signed and returned

IPEB: AWAITING RESULTS

01 APR 2022:
PEBLO sends package to IPEB
04 APR 2022: AFPC Emails me saying they have received my MEB package at the IPEB.
